City of Richmond, Indiana,
Monday October 26th, 19_31.
The Special Council Committee, Board of Public Works of the
City of Richmond, Indiana, met in regular session at the office
of said Board, on Monday October 26th, 1931, at 9 o 'clock A. M.
All the members of said Board, Messrs, Ford, Crabb. and Schnied-
er being present.. The following proceedings were had, to-wit :
The minutes of the proceeding meeting were read and approved.
Mr. D. C. Hess, Sup °t. , of Light Plant, reported that in inves-
tigating the plans submitted With the various bids received for
Two boiler feed pumps, that all bids be rejected other than the
bids submitted, by the Dean Hill Pump Co. , of Anddrson, Indiana,
end the Worthington Pump & Machinery Co. , of Cincinnati, Ohio. ,
The Board thereupon authorize Mr. Hess, to return the certified
checks deposited with bids .for said pumps, except the Dean-Hill
Pump Co. , and the Worthington Pump & Machinery Co. ,
The Board directed the a.E.L.& P.P. to advertise for bids for
furnishing the plant with a 15,000 Turbo Generator, to be in-
tailed at said plant. .
. The Clerk was directed to advertise for heating plant to be in-
stalled in No. 4- Hose House, according to plans and specifica-
tions prepared by the City Civil Engineer.
Claims in amount of $8853.80 were allowed.
The Board instruct the Street Commissioner to roughin the road
on east Main Street east of Glen Park, or to place a non-skid
surface on road, under the directions of City Engineer.
The Special Council Committee
Board of Public Works
then adjourned.
